Many people fall into misconceptions during trading, always focusing on how to pursue higher profits but neglecting the importance of risk control. When the market moves favorably and they make some profit, they become overconfident, relax their risk management, and blindly increase their investments. Once the market reverses, they are powerless to respond, losing not only all profits but also their principal. This is like going on a spring outing, only paying attention to the beautiful scenery, forgetting to prepare for sudden heavy rain, and ending up soaked and embarrassed.



The market is always fair, and also cruel. It never disappoints those who respect risk, nor does it spare those who ignore it. Risk control is the first line of defense in trading, and also the last. It won't make you rich overnight, but it can help you avoid huge losses; it won't let you catch every market move, but it can help you preserve the profits you've already gained.

Using consistent risk control to face ever-changing market conditions is the long-term way of trading. No matter how the market fluctuates or how the timing changes, always adhere to the risk management bottom line, respect the market, and stay true to your original intention.
